Hanson Professional Services Inc. is seeking a candidate to fill a full‑time Site Civil Engineer position in either our McHenry, IL, Peoria, IL, or Houston, TX office. Consideration of additional locations for the right candidate could include Lisle, IL; Kansas City, MO; St. Louis, MO; or Springfield, IL, as will fully remote scenarios.
This person is expected to work as part of multidisciplinary design teams to plan and execute infrastructure projects for a variety of clients primarily within the industrial, site development, ports/multimodal freight, and manufacturing areas, with opportunities to work on projects in other markets, such as Power and Infrastructure.
Projects are likely to include reconstruction and rehabilitation of industrial infrastructure such as roads, rail, utilities; highways and roads, culverts and storm sewer, stormwater detention, rail grade crossings, signing, pavement marking, and traffic control plans for construction.
Greenfield and Brownfield projects may include site development or redevelopment. Power projects may include substations, solar farms, wind farms, and battery storage facilities, while Infrastructure projects may include municipal projects, bike trails, parks, parking lots, and commercial site development.
Position requires the ability to serve as a key member of the project design team developing designs and providing direction to junior-level engineers and CADD/Technician staff in the areas of civil and site design including but not limited to; grading, storm water design, rail and roadways, utilities, and agency and railroad coordination.
Position requires the ability to work on a variety of projects, take directions from multiple project managers, and coordinate with other staff.

A bachelor's degree in civil engineering or related field is required.
5 or more years of general civil engineering experience with an emphasis on site development.
Railway and/or roadway engineering experience is a plus.
Professional Engineer license in state of assigned office or the ability to reciprocate from another state within 6 months.
Additional licensure as a Professional Engineer in Texas and/or Louisiana or in a Canadian province would be viewed favorably.
